Electric bicycles are having their best moment in years. Although they have been around for a long time, it is only now that the massive adoption of these vehicles is taking off. Many people have realized the various benefits an electric bike offers. First and foremost, anyone can take up cycling using an e-bike. You don’t need to be particularly fit to start riding this type of two-wheeler.

People decide to buy electric bike bikes for a variety of reasons. Manufacturers respond by offering specialized e-bikes for different applications like city commuting, leisure, and mountain biking. This list is not exhaustive. Moreover, some electric bikes are good for two or even more applications. In all these cases, we’re referring to a bicycle equipped with a motor to assist the rider on difficult terrain.

Hence, the feel is quite similar to a conventional pedal bike. However, in more demanding conditions such as pedaling uphill, the pedal-assist mechanism will engage. You will feel more powerful. That is, you won’t require huge physical effort to overcome challenging terrain. But don’t expect an electric bike to perform and feel like a motorcycle.

Why Use a Premium Bike for City Commuting?

Electric bicycles are available in different price categories. Which ebike for commuting you choose depends on your budget, of course. However, as with many other things, you get what you pay for. Using a premium bike for city commuting has advantages that budget e-bikes don’t. The most important advantages are the following:

  •  Suitable for all weather conditions. If you buy an electric bike for commuting, you likely plan on using it all year round. It means that you will experience different weather conditions as the seasons change. Premium e-bikes are equipped with fenders, chain cover, and integrated lights for rainy days. They also offer the option to change the regular tires for winter tires to ride on snow and icy terrain.
  •   Higher durability. To commute, you’ll be riding your e-bike almost daily. Hence, the different parts of your vehicle will wear rapidly if they are not of premium quality. In the long run, it is much more cost-effective to invest in an electric bike with premium components. It makes sense to pay for a high-end battery, carbon belt drive, puncture-resistant tires, and other quality parts.
  •  Much more comfortable. While commuting, you’ll likely ride on bumpy terrain that can be quite uncomfortable. Premium commuting e-bikes solve this issue by including high-volume tires, an adjustable suspension fork, rear suspension, and ergonomic touch points (grips, saddle, etc.).
  •  Cargo options. If you commute to work, you often need to carry with you a laptop, papers, and/or materials. Some people try to solve this problem by using a backpack while riding to work. However, carrying a backpack is uncomfortable. Moreover, you will probably get to your workplace with a sweaty back. Instead, premium electric bikes offer the possibility to mount compatible racks or side boxes. With such accessories, you can commute quite comfortably while carrying all you need for work.
